Transaction 53aab1f05242e8069ada78935d97f7ad47e11c3664a389938eca98745f8734d5
1 Input
1 Output
-
53aab1f05242e8069ada78935d97f7ad47e11c3664a389938eca98745f8734d5:0
- value
- 1356911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 890c334f8053d1d78316982ac0ceae8835a5674f OP_EQUAL
- address
- MLPoRQqcug2tFShvQqbrrPD6iioesTLqUf